Summer is all about fun, sun, and staying cool—but that doesn’t mean you have to sacrifice style. When the temperature rises, the key is to choose lightweight, breathable fabrics and loose-fitting silhouettes that keep you comfortable while still looking put-together. These summer outfit ideas are perfect for hot days, from beach days to brunch, and they’re all easy to throw on and go.
For a beach day or a trip to the pool, opt for a flowy maxi dress in a bright, fun print (think florals, stripes, or tropical patterns). Pair it with flat sandals, a wide-brimmed hat, and a crossbody bag to hold your sunscreen, sunglasses, and phone. The maxi dress is lightweight and loose, so it won’t stick to your skin, and the print adds a playful, summery vibe. After the beach, you can even throw on a denim jacket if the evening gets cool.
For a casual brunch or a day out shopping, try a linen jumpsuit in a neutral color (beige, white, or light blue). Linen is perfect for summer—it’s breathable and lightweight, and it has a relaxed, effortless look. Pair the jumpsuit with espadrilles or white sneakers, and add a straw tote bag and sunglasses. Keep jewelry minimal: a pair of hoop earrings or a dainty bracelet. This look is comfortable, stylish, and perfect for hot days.
If you want a more polished summer look (for a lunch date or a day at the office), try a linen button-down shirt (tucked in or left loose) paired with high-waisted denim shorts. Add ankle strap sandals and a small crossbody bag. The linen shirt keeps you cool, while the denim shorts add a casual, summery touch. You can also add a belt to cinch your waist and add a little structure to the look.
